must remain six Weeks in the Bottle shaking it frequently every Day Then strain it through blotting Paper and bottle it off for use-NB by adding tow or three Drops of (illegible) it will give it- a pink colour- To cure the Gravel in the Kidneys or Bladder Take 10 Drops of agua kali(?) pura in a quart 5 Drops in a pint, and 10 in proper (illegible) for a (illegible) quantity of ale you drink be it what it may, at every Meal, or between Meals. Note the agua kali pura is a Caustic and will burn any thing before it is diluted; therefore it should be kept in a Bottle with a slap stopper as it would rot a Cork, and it will rot a burn in the Pod (illegible) if any should ooze thru' the stopper- Shorten Jelly to cure a (illegible....) Candied (illegible) Root-- 1 oz Pearl Barley-- 1 oz Rice-- 1 oz (illegible)-- 1 oz (illegible)-- 1 oz simmer the above 5 ounces in three pints of Water till reduced to a quart and strain it thru' a sieve when cold it will form a jelly of which give a teacupful warmed in milk, Broth or Wine and (illegible) as the usual nourishment-
